Unlike morrison"s god help the child or loom, acker"s novel has various voices but no distinction between the voices. Written in the early eighties, and has something aesthetically to do with punk culture (after all, acker was also a punk poet) Punk culture was also changing gender norms, sexuality, and sexual fluidity. Great expectations is considered to be a radical, feminist critique. The writing style itself is also very radical - this comes from the french feminist idea of writing with you body . Writing is more fluid and doesn"t tend to objectivity. Since our experiences with our bodies are different, our body" of writing is also different.
